About AI-Driven Software Development
AI-Driven Software Development is Clear Measure's service for .NET and Azure organizations that want to use AI across the software delivery lifecycle rather than limiting it to code completion. The company describes the approach as applying AI from requirements and design through implementation, testing, deployment and production monitoring. The service is aimed at teams that want faster delivery without removing architecture, quality controls or human engineering judgment from the process.
What does AI-driven software development mean here?
Clear Measure distinguishes AI-driven development from simply giving developers coding assistants. Its model applies AI to the wider delivery system, including requirements, design, coding, testing, deployment and operations. The purpose is to reduce manual friction across the lifecycle while preserving controls that help teams judge whether generated work is correct, complete and safe to release. Buyers should expect process redesign and engineering governance to matter as much as tool selection.
Who is this service for?
The service is most relevant to software organizations already working with .NET, Azure or related Microsoft delivery tooling and looking to increase output without lowering reliability. It can fit modernization programs, new strategic applications and teams that already use AI coding tools but have not connected those tools to testing, deployment and operational feedback. Organizations with weak architecture, unstable environments or unclear ownership may need an inspection or project recovery step before broad AI adoption.
What risks should buyers consider?
AI can accelerate both good and bad engineering practices. Faster code generation does not guarantee stronger architecture, complete requirements, adequate testing or correct production behavior. Clear Measure's published AI material emphasizes external validation and engineering oversight because large language models cannot reliably judge the quality of their own output. Buyers should evaluate how generated changes are reviewed, tested, traced and promoted through environments before measuring success only by developer speed.
How is this different from AI DevOps Inspection?
AI-Driven Software Development is an implementation-oriented service. AI DevOps Inspection is diagnostic and asks whether the organization is ready to adopt AI-driven delivery safely. A team that already has clear architecture, automated testing, stable deployment practices and strong engineering ownership may move directly into implementation. A team with uncertain controls may benefit from the inspection first so investment is directed at the gaps that would otherwise make AI adoption riskier.
What should buyers define before starting?
Teams should identify the software outcome they want to improve, current delivery cycle time, testing maturity, deployment automation, source-control practices and production feedback loops. They should also define where human approval remains mandatory and what evidence is required before a generated change can move forward. These decisions help distinguish useful automation from simply adding more tools to an already inconsistent workflow.
Who should choose something else?
A buyer that only needs a conventional custom application may prefer Custom .NET Software Development without making AI transformation the center of the engagement. Organizations with a failing project should consider Project Rescue first. Teams mainly seeking executive guidance can look at Fractional Leadership. The AI-driven service is strongest when the objective is to redesign how software is delivered with AI while keeping engineering quality and operational control visible.
